
The Sharp End by John Ellis
Examines the actual physical and mental experiences of the American and British front-line soldier in World War II. This book is the result of research among memoirs published and unpublished and little-known official records in an attempt to explain what war meant to the individual soldier.| SKU | Unavailable |
